Flywheel energy storage or fes is a storage device which stores/maintains kinetic energy through a rotor/flywheel rotation. Flywheel energy storage systems (fess) are a great way to store and use energy. Energy storage flywheels are usually supported by active magnetic bearing (amb) systems to avoid friction loss. That is, it stores energy in the form of kinetic energy rather than as chemical energy as does a conventional electrical battery. The core element of a flywheel consists of a rotating mass, typically axisymmetric, which stores rotary kinetic. Theoretically, the flywheel should be able to both store and extract energy quickly, and release it, both at high speeds and without any limit on the total number of cycles possible in its lifetime.
